
底层数据分析师需要掌握的基本技能有:数据收集、数据清洗、数据分析、数据可视化、编程能力、统计学知识、业务理解。其中,数据清洗尤为重要,这是因为数据清洗是确保数据质量的关键步骤。底层数据分析师通常面对的是原始数据,这些数据可能会包含各种错误、缺失值、不一致性等问题。如果不进行有效的数据清洗,这些问题将会直接影响后续的分析结果。数据清洗的过程包括数据验证、数据修正、数据转换等多个步骤,目的是将原始数据转化为高质量的数据,以便进行后续的分析和处理。数据清洗不仅需要耐心,还需要掌握各种工具和方法,确保数据的完整性和准确性。
一、数据收集
底层数据分析师的工作从数据收集开始。数据收集是指从各种数据源获取数据的过程。数据源可以是内部系统、外部API、第三方数据提供商、公开数据集等。对于数据分析师来说,数据收集不仅是一个技术问题,还涉及到数据源的选择、数据的合法性和数据的质量等问题。数据收集的好坏直接影响到后续分析的质量。例如,对于一个电商平台的底层数据分析师来说,数据收集可能包括从网站日志中提取用户行为数据、从数据库中提取订单数据、从外部API获取市场行情数据等。
二、数据清洗
数据清洗是数据分析过程中极其重要的一步。原始数据往往包含各种错误、缺失值、不一致性等问题。如果不进行有效的数据清洗,这些问题将会直接影响后续的分析结果。数据清洗的目标是将原始数据转化为高质量的数据,以便进行后续的分析和处理。数据清洗的过程包括数据验证、数据修正、数据转换等多个步骤。数据验证是指检查数据的完整性和一致性,确保数据没有明显的错误。数据修正是指修正数据中的错误,例如填补缺失值、修正错误的数据格式等。数据转换是指将数据转换为分析所需的格式,例如将字符串转换为数值、将日期格式转换为标准日期格式等。
三、数据分析
数据分析是数据分析师的核心工作。数据分析是指通过各种方法和工具,对数据进行深入分析,挖掘数据中的潜在价值。数据分析的方法包括描述性分析、探索性分析、因果分析、预测分析等。描述性分析是指对数据进行基本的描述和总结,例如计算均值、中位数、标准差等。探索性分析是指通过数据的可视化和统计分析,发现数据中的模式和规律。因果分析是指通过实验和统计方法,验证数据中的因果关系。预测分析是指通过机器学习和统计模型,对数据进行预测。数据分析的目标是通过对数据的深入分析,发现数据中的潜在价值,支持业务决策。
四、数据可视化
数据可视化是数据分析的一个重要环节。数据可视化是指通过图表、图形等方式,将数据的分析结果直观地展示出来。数据可视化的目的是使数据的分析结果更容易理解,便于决策者做出决策。数据可视化的方法包括柱状图、折线图、饼图、散点图、热力图等。对于底层数据分析师来说,数据可视化不仅需要掌握各种可视化工具和方法,还需要具备良好的审美和设计能力,以确保数据的可视化效果。
五、编程能力
编程能力是底层数据分析师的基本技能。编程能力不仅包括掌握一种或多种编程语言,还包括掌握各种数据处理和分析工具。常用的编程语言包括Python、R、SQL等。Python和R是数据分析中常用的编程语言,具有丰富的数据处理和分析库,如Pandas、NumPy、Matplotlib、Scikit-learn等。SQL是数据库查询语言,用于从数据库中提取和操作数据。编程能力是数据分析师提高工作效率、处理复杂数据分析任务的重要工具。
六、统计学知识
统计学知识是数据分析的理论基础。统计学知识包括概率论、统计推断、回归分析、假设检验等。掌握统计学知识,可以帮助数据分析师理解数据的分布和规律,进行有效的数据分析和预测。例如,概率论可以帮助数据分析师理解数据的随机性和不确定性,统计推断可以帮助数据分析师进行样本数据的推断和估计,回归分析可以帮助数据分析师建立数据的预测模型,假设检验可以帮助数据分析师验证数据的假设。
七、业务理解
业务理解是数据分析师的重要能力之一。数据分析不仅是一个技术问题,还涉及到对业务的理解和支持。业务理解可以帮助数据分析师更好地理解数据的背景和意义,进行有效的数据分析和决策支持。例如,对于一个电商平台的底层数据分析师来说,业务理解可能包括了解电商平台的业务流程、用户行为模式、市场竞争情况等。业务理解还可以帮助数据分析师更好地沟通和合作,与业务人员一起解决业务问题。
总结:底层数据分析师的工作涉及多个方面,包括数据收集、数据清洗、数据分析、数据可视化、编程能力、统计学知识、业务理解等。每一个方面都有其重要性和难点,需要数据分析师具备相应的知识和技能。底层数据分析师的目标是通过对数据的深入分析,发现数据中的潜在价值,支持业务决策。FineBI是一个强大的数据分析工具,可以帮助底层数据分析师更高效地进行数据分析和决策支持。FineBI官网: https://s.fanruan.com/f459r;
相关问答FAQs:
底层数据分析师的主要职责是什么?
底层数据分析师的主要职责是从各种数据源中收集、整理和分析数据,以支持决策制定和业务优化。工作涉及数据清洗、数据挖掘、数据可视化以及报告撰写等多个方面。在具体工作中,分析师需要使用不同的数据处理工具和编程语言,如SQL、Python或R,来处理大规模数据集。此外,底层数据分析师还需要与其他团队成员合作,例如产品经理、市场营销团队和工程师,以确保分析结果能够有效地转化为业务策略和操作决策。
在工作中,数据分析师需深入理解所处行业的市场动态、用户需求及竞争对手行为,从而提供有价值的见解。通过数据洞察,分析师可以帮助企业识别趋势、发现潜在问题,并提出解决方案。这些职责不仅要求具备技术能力,还需要良好的沟通能力,以便将复杂的数据分析结果清晰地传达给非技术团队成员。
成为底层数据分析师需要哪些技能和工具?
成为一名合格的底层数据分析师需要掌握多种技能和使用不同的工具。首先,数据处理和分析的基础技能不可或缺,例如熟练使用Excel进行数据整理和分析。其次,掌握数据库管理系统(DBMS),如MySQL或PostgreSQL,能够帮助分析师高效地存取和管理数据。对于更复杂的数据处理,编程技能显得尤为重要,Python和R语言是数据分析领域中常用的编程语言,它们提供了丰富的数据处理库和工具,能帮助分析师进行更深入的分析。
此外,数据可视化技能也是不可或缺的,使用工具如Tableau、Power BI或Matplotlib等,可以将复杂数据以图表、仪表盘等形式呈现,帮助团队更直观地理解数据。对于底层数据分析师来说,统计学基础也是必备的,了解基本的统计方法能帮助分析师更准确地解释数据结果。
除了技术技能外,底层数据分析师还需要具备良好的沟通能力和团队合作精神,因为分析结果需要与其他团队分享,以便制定出更有效的业务策略。
底层数据分析师在职业发展中有哪些前景和挑战?
底层数据分析师的职业发展前景广阔,随着企业对数据驱动决策的重视,数据分析师的需求持续增加。入门级的底层数据分析师可以通过积累经验和技能提升,逐步晋升为高级数据分析师、数据科学家或数据工程师等更高级别的职位。许多公司也提供内部培训和职业发展机会,帮助分析师不断提升自己的专业能力。
然而,底层数据分析师在职业发展过程中也面临一些挑战。数据量的不断增长要求分析师不断学习新的工具和技术,以跟上行业发展潮流。此外,随着自动化和人工智能技术的应用,部分数据分析工作可能会被替代,这要求分析师不断提升自己的专业能力,向更高层次的分析和决策支持转型。
在面对这些挑战时,底层数据分析师应保持学习的心态,积极参加培训和行业交流,扩展自己的知识和技能。同时,培养跨领域的能力,例如业务理解、项目管理和团队协作能力,也将有助于提升职业竞争力。在不断变化的市场环境中,灵活应对挑战并抓住机遇,将是底层数据分析师职业发展的关键所在。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



